Eastminster is a abbey in london. Established 1301. (Medieval abbey in London.) Wikipedia notes: "Eastminster, also known as New Abbey, St Mary Graces, and other variants, was a Cistercian abbey on Tower Hill at East Smithfield in London.". Coordinates 51.5086°, -0.0719°.
